About this listen
Marcus Didius Falco and his friend Petronius find their local fountain has been blocked - by a severed human hand. Soon other body parts are being found in the aqueducts & sewers. The Aventine partners are commissioned to investigate.

Narration is by Christian Rodska, and is vibrant and enthusiastic, with individual voicing for the assorted characters, although all of his female protagonists have a verbal cartoon quality which adds humour but is nevertheless annoying. His performance is good but for me it is always Anton Lesser who is the true voice of Falco.
As always, three Hands in the Fountain is such a pleasure for any reader with a fondness for books set in this period - and a good mystery , as well.

Rodska is the best narrator, and he brings this novel to life. It is very straight forward and not as complcated as some of the other books in the series. Descriptions abound and it is an action driven novel that keeps you right up there with Falco.
Helena and her brothers are there, but more as supporting characters, leaving Marcus and Petro to lead the way.
